## Further Reading

The Farebright pricing experiment changed how weekday matinee tickets are bucketed, so some customers on older plans may see totals that differ from the published rate card. Support should treat these as expected behavior, not billing errors, while the experiment runs. Refunds follow the standard Farebright policy with no exceptions for experiment cohorts. Full cohort definitions, rollout dates, and escalation criteria are on the internal experiment page.

operations page: https://jenkins.zemvarcloud.local/job/merge_requests/repo/build/73930b4b30f0a8ed

## Deploying the Gatewick Proctor Queue

Deploys are pretty painless: push to main, wait for the pipeline, then watch the queue drain dashboard for five minutes. If candidates pile up mid-exam, roll back first and ask questions later — the queue replays safely. Everything the workers care about lives in one config block, shown here for reference.

settings of bafof-yagef:
JOROX_PIN=8740
JOROX_TENANT=pelox
JOROX_METRICS_HOST=metrics.jorox.qorvelworks.internal
JOROX_SEAL=seal_c78f63c1
JOROX_STANDBY_TEAM=norax

**Action item:** Shard the Plimmer user-profile store by account hash before the next growth milestone. A new contractor will own the migration: build the shard-routing layer first, then backfill in batches, then cut reads over shard by shard. Keep dual-writes on until checksums match for a full week. The routing and backfill parameters we agreed on are these.

tuning constants:
QUOTAS = {
    "druwyn": 5,
    "holix": 5,
    "zorath": 5,
    "holwyn": 10,
}

Subject: DR drill — timing-chip readers

Future maintainers: on the 14th we rehearsed full failover for the Fernhollow marathon timing-chip readers. We simulated loss of the trackside gateway at mile 18, confirmed chip reads buffered locally for six minutes, then replayed cleanly to the standby collector. One lesson: always verify clock sync before replay, or split times drift. To restore the standby collector's sealed config, enter the passphrase below.

unlock words, kagef-taduf: fenir-quenix-norwyn-sorvan-gormir-gorir-fraok